Genesis 3:21 – The Lord God made garments of skin for Adam and his wife and clothed them.

The only way to get skin from an animal is to kill it… so we know this was the first animal sacrifice. Adam and Eve had never seen an animal die. But, naked and ashamed, they needed the animal’s skin to cover their humiliation.

To make His point, God may have made them watch the slaughter of this innocent victim: throat slit, body trembling, it was a bloody object lesson to portray the terrible cost of sin.

The Old Testament is filled with the blood of sacrificial animals — sheep, goats, bulls, and more. But all the blood of all the animals ever sacrificed could never take away sins, says the book of Hebrews. That required nothing less than the shed blood of Jesus Christ — God in human flesh.

Sin is man taking the place of God. Our salvation came through God taking the place of man. Adam and Eve were clothed with the skin of a beast, but all who believe are clothed with the righteousness of Jesus Christ.

Just like clothes cover our physical shame, the blood of Christ covers the shame of our hearts… and presents them white as snow to God.

The first animal sacrifice pointed ahead to the sacrifice of Christ.
